Episode 2451 was broadcast on 4 February 1999, as part of Series 40.
Gill Russell Smith played James Illingworth, with Gill Russell Smith winning 56 - 43. The Dictionary Corner guest was John Dunn, and the lexicographer was Damian Eadie.
